What are the best settings for photographing the moon?

When photographing the moon, use a tripod to keep the camera steady, set a low ISO for less noise, use a long focal length lens, and a fast shutter speed to capture details. Experiment with different settings to find the best results.


Is Debye-Scherrer method and powder method are samething?

Definition of DEBYE-SCHERRER METHOD: a method of forming a diffraction pattern by directing a beam of X rays onto an aggregate of small crystals (as in the powdered form of a substance) and by photographing the pattern so formed to provide a means of identifying crystalline substances
